Transaction 07d6328c430f345bc1a41141b4d4a7d612f4845fbfc3b8b51ac28eefd42ef9e6
1 Input
2 Outputs
- 07d6328c430f345bc1a41141b4d4a7d612f4845fbfc3b8b51ac28eefd42ef9e6:0
- 07d6328c430f345bc1a41141b4d4a7d612f4845fbfc3b8b51ac28eefd42ef9e6:1
value 3593080
address 1K41frXGW9MimNCLctXAVt2uiTG3CkAm2a
value 2000000
address 36pMWTueajPtnovYnnmfTmtrpovtnxNdMi